Output 36573657c3b91027fa91795afb0bf116b9e82af43edf706621ea7d89c9f5e89e:17

value
24418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8d7ad5465a8dbeb4f1a53dfb10e326ad339426f OP_EQUAL
address
3NvB4Z5WiHZvLNR57ayMutGs7phk3LjyvD
transaction
36573657c3b91027fa91795afb0bf116b9e82af43edf706621ea7d89c9f5e89e